Tech. Sgt. Lee Lopez, 309th Aircraft Maintenance Group expeditionary depot maintenance fuel systems team member, replaces the wings on an A-10 Thunderbolt II assigned to the 357th Fighter Generation Squadron at Davis-Monthan Air Force Base, Arizona, Oct. 11, 2022. Completing this process at DM expedited the wing swap process and added approximately 7.3 thousand hours back into the flying program, placing three jets back into the working system of completing missions, sorties and countless training requirements.
